Charles Robert Schwab Sr. (born July 29, 1937) is an American investor and financial executive. He is the founder and chairman of the Charles Schwab Corporation. He pioneered discount sales of equity securities starting in 1975. His company became by far the largest discount securities dealer in the United States.

Mr. Schwab is the founder of the company and served as its sole chief executive for most of its history since its founding in the early 1970s. His vision continues to drive the company’s growth today. Mr. Schwab has been co-chair of The Charles Schwab Corporation with Chief Executive Officer Walter W. Bettinger II since July 2022.
